What Is the Cost of Living Near Norfolk?

Understanding the cost of living near Norfolk is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Sunset Hill.
Norfolk's Cost of Living Index is approximately 95.3 (4.7% less expensive than US average; 8.5% less than VA average). Hampton Roads city, major naval base, historic, affordable housing. HRT bus/light rail/ferry. When planning your budget based on a salary from Sunset Hill,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,100 - $1,600+ A significant portion of Sunset Hill sal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70 (HRT mon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$580 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$360 - $680+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,440 - $3,780+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
